“Then he said to me, "This is the word of the LORD to Zerubbabel: Not by might, nor by power, but by my Spirit, says the LORD of hosts.” (Zechariah 4:6)
Zerubbabel was a Jewish leader who led a large group of Jews - still in Babylonian captivity but with permission from its King, Cyrus the Great - back to Israel to rebuild the temple which had been destroyed as God had foretold for its disobedience to His commandments.
God is omnipotent (all powerful) and orders ‘all’ things - good and tragic - to achieve His purposes. We can look back on our own lives to see how the twists and turns, sometimes unbeknownst to us, have brought us to the present moment leaving us in awe; yes He uses us to play an active physical role; but, if we are honest with ourselves, it's too much to have done it entirely on our own.
We must always examine our conscience, confess our offenses against God, and trust in His mercy to bring good out of all things.
